    How can solar energy be integrated?

    By 2030, as much as 80% of electricity could flow through power electronic devices. One type of power electronic device that is particularly important for solar energy integration is the inverter. Inverters convert DC electricity, which is what a solar panel generates, to AC electricity, which the electrical grid uses.

    How does solar power work?

    With the integration of solar power systems, electricity can now flow in both directions. This two-way electricity flow is made possible through advanced grid infrastructure and smart technologies. Solar energy systems generate electricity during the day, and any excess energy can be fed back into the grid.
